A family that hunts together, stays together—and works together in the case of William Larkin Moore & Sons. In business since 1968, father Bill and sons Dan and David have been importing guns from Europe, building reputations based on quality, trust and great customer service. When they’re not at shows or in the field, the Moores are in their shop, in Scottsdale, Arizona—selling fine sporting arms from makers such as Arrizabalaga, Chapuis, FAMARS, Piotti,
F.lli Rizzini, Lebeau-Courally, Armas Garbi and B. Rizzini.
Their racks are always full of interesting pieces, like these Lebeau-Courally 20-bores (right)—a side-by-side (top) and an over/under, both with 28" barrels and engraving by Alain Lovenberg.
Let’s look around…
This Piotti Monaco No. 1 20-bore has 29" barrels, extraordinary wood, ornamental scroll engraving, and a cameo game scene with flushing quail by Gianfranco Pedersoli.
This F.lli Rizzini R1E 12-gauge (above) has two sets of barrels (28" choked IC/M & 29" choked M/F) and extra-quality ornamental scroll engraving by Contessa Albino.
This Armas Garbi Model 103A 20-gauge has 29" barrels choked IC/M and deluxe ornamental scroll engraving.
Or what about a J.P. Sauer Model 40 12-bore fowler (right), a Stephen Grant 16-bore with 28" barrels choked IC/M and fine scroll engraving (opposite), a Hollis & Sons .450/400 Nitro Express (below) or a John Rigby .470 Nitro Express (bottom)?
